Social Epidemiology
Summary
Social epidemiology investigates how social structures, relationships and policies shape patterns of health and disease in populations. It emphasises that health emerges not only from individual risk factors but from an interplay of material conditions, community environments, social networks and power relations. By examining differences in wealth distribution, educational opportunities, employment conditions, neighbourhood characteristics and cultural norms, social epidemiologists trace pathways linking social advantage or disadvantage with vulnerability to infection, chronic illness and mental distress. They deploy lifecourse perspectives to show how early‐life exposures to hardship or privilege accumulate over time and interact with biological processes, while multilevel frameworks reveal how local contexts—from workplaces to metropolitan regions—influence individual health beyond personal behaviours. Ultimately, social epidemiology combines statistical rigour with theory from sociology, economics and political science to inform interventions that address upstream drivers of health inequities and guide policies towards greater social justice.

A cluster‐randomised trial in Australian schools evaluated a six‐domain health behaviour intervention targeting diet, sleep, physical activity, screen time, alcohol and smoking. While short‐term improvements in psychological distress and depressive symptoms were observed, effects waned by one year, highlighting the challenge of sustaining multi‐component programmes in adolescence.
Latent class analysis of half a million UK Biobank participants identified distinct lifestyle risk profiles—ranging from high alcohol and sedentary patterns to combinations including poor diet and inactivity—and showed that membership in clusters with two or more risk behaviours was associated with markedly higher cardiovascular disease incidence and risk scores, underscoring the need for integrated prevention strategies.
In Norway, harmonised registry and survey data on over 800,000 adults were used to map trajectories of smoking, physical activity, body mass index, blood pressure and lipids. Five clusters of key non‐communicable disease risk factors emerged, each characterised by lower income and education, while long‐term trajectories revealed differing patterns of risk accumulation, providing a blueprint for tailored interventions.

Technical terms
Social determinant: A social or economic factor—such as income, education or neighbourhood environment—that influences health outcomes.
Health inequality: Systematic differences in health status or access to care between population groups defined by social, economic or demographic factors.
Multilevel analysis: Statistical modelling that accounts for influences operating at more than one hierarchical level (for example, individual and neighbourhood) on health outcomes.
Lifecourse approach: Framework assessing how exposures from gestation through adulthood accumulate and interact to affect later health.
Cluster‐randomised trial: An intervention study in which groups (for example, schools or communities), rather than individuals, are randomly allocated to treatments.
Machine learning: Computational methods that enable prediction or classification by learning patterns from large, complex datasets.
